Word: Continue

Speech Type: Verb

Etymology:

Middle English: from Old French continuer, from Latin continuare, from continuus (see continuous)

Audio Pronunciation:
Phonetic Spelling: kənˈtɪnjuː
Dialects: British English
Definition:

persist in an activity or process

Short Definition:

persist in activity

Examples:
  • he was unable to continue with his job
  • prices continued to fall during April
Definition:

recommence or resume after interruption

Short Definition:

recommence after interruption

Examples:
  • we continue the story from the point reached in Chapter 1
  • the trial continues tomorrow
